Definitions
(verb) move outward. Synonyms: spread, spread out, fan out. Example: "The soldiers fanned out."
Verb Definition 1
(verb) spread or diffuse through. Synonyms: permeate, pervade, penetrate, interpenetrate, imbue, riddle. Examples: "An atmosphere of distrust has permeated this administration." "Music penetrated the entire building." "His campaign was riddled with accusations and personal attacks."
Verb Definition 2
(verb) cause to become widely known. Synonyms: circulate, circularize, circularise, distribute, disseminate, propagate, broadcast, spread, disperse, pass around. Examples: "Spread information." "Circulate a rumor." "Broadcast the news."
Verb Definition 3
(adj) spread out; not concentrated in one place. Example: "A large diffuse organization."
Adjective Definition 1
(adj) (of light) transmitted from a broad light source or reflected. Synonyms: soft (vs. hard), diffused.
